Family Run Contacting Business G Robinsons Ltd (Rugeley, Staffordshire)
Massey Ferguson 8S.225 & 7719S
Family run contracting business G Robinson LTD based near Rugeley, Staffordshire have grown an impressive business since they began in 2013. Father and Son team Graham and Shaun took the decision to venture into agricultural contracting nearly 8 years ago and have consistently worked to secure key contracts around the country and push the business forward.
Now the family manage a team of 8 tractor drivers completing various agricultural activities year-round.
“No job is too big or place too far when it comes to us. We will always provide a great service wherever the work comes from. We have Anaerobic Digestion Plants, central and further afield with various contracts that our team of drivers travel to. We know we offer a good service and competitive prices which has helped us retain important business each year” explains Graham.
With work coming in throughout the year, the team relies on good machines to support the workload. The business recently took delivery of two new Massey Ferguson tractors from KO Machines LTD; a 7719S and 8S.225 Dyna 7.
“Like anyone, we have to have reliable machinery and we need good service from our local dealer. Our tractors average about 2000 hours per year and in peak times we need to feel supported. We have had a few machines from KO and we have always been impressed with their service so we decided to take the plunge and go for two new tractors this year.”
After successful demonstrations Graham and Shaun were left particularly impressed with the new Massey Ferguson 8S model, commenting specifically on the improvements made to the cab. Both tractors were delivered to the team in March 2021 with the 8S already clocking up over 600 hours.
“The process with KO Machines has been fantastic, both sales and service. The team really know what they are doing and they are a great bunch, nothing is too much trouble. When it comes to purchasing a new machine, reliability is key but also a competitively priced machine. When comparing to other brands we found the Massey Ferguson machines to be very sensible. That, paired with the affordable service charge from KO, we felt confident we had a good deal.” Explains Graham and Shaun.

Family Run Contracting & Farming Business Brewster Farms (Staffordshire)
Massey Ferguson Cerea 7274 & Delta 9380 Combine Harvesters
Brewster Farms is a family-run farming and contracting business based in Staffordshire. Operating for over 40 years and loyal KO Machines customers, we wanted to chat more about their love for Massey Ferguson and why they choose KO in particular.
The business operates in the area around the farm and up to Stafford, and in total the machines are tending to over 3000 acres of ground with a variation of crops including OSR, barley, wheat, oats and beans.
“Pretty much all our machines are Massey Ferguson and supplied through KO Machines. We started dealing with them when they originally set up in 2008. With the depot only being five miles away we always feel well looked after by the team” explains Matt Brewster.
The business currently runs two Massey Ferguson combines; a Cerea 7274 and the most recently purchased Delta 9380. “We didn’t really shop around when it came to changing, we knew we liked the Massey product and knew we would be well looked-after by KO Machines.”
The newest member of the fleet is comfortably capable of harvesting in excess of 90 acres per day and receives great results. “When it comes to output we are very happy, it performs well and it isn’t thirsty, not with fuel or AdBlue. We did have the IDEAL 7T here last season and it flew past but granted it is a bigger machine. We also really like the SuperFlow header in comparison to the older PowerFlow model.”
Previously running competitive brands of machines, Matt explained how the sample produced by the combine was of a lot higher quality than previous competitive models, “Whilst the machine allows you to slow down rotor speed to maintain good straw quality, we have not found this compromises the grain sample. This latest model is by far the best grain and straw samples we have seen.”
When it comes to time in the seat it is driver James that has logged the most hours, and here he explains the ease of functionality from inside the cab, “Everything is so easy to use and find. The touchscreen display and general user experience is great, it makes the machine a pleasure to drive.”
What is a good combine without good back-up? With any machine the customer wants to feel looked after and we were pleased to find that this was the case with Brewster Farms.
“We really have no complaints, the whole process with KO Machines from purchasing to back-up and parts is brilliant. If they don’t have the parts we need on the shelf, then they sort us out from the warehouse. The longest we were broken down in harvest was a couple of hours and that was in the evening time. The engineers understand the importance of getting us up and running quickly and they aren’t shy of being here first thing in the morning either, which I have found to be a problem with other companies.”
The families love of the Massey Ferguson brand doesn’t end with their two combines. The farm also runs six tractors, all supplied by KO Machines; four 7700 S series and two 7600 series.
“The fact that most of our equipment in the business is supplied through KO machines I think speaks for itself in terms of how happy we are with the overall service. Both KO and Massey Ferguson are always a pleasure to deal with and cannot do enough for you. You really feel that they are passionate about putting the customer first.”
